Output 1bb80c104d720dd19ca553bee163fa7c7c12a68ea61cfc5695a88ffe0026cd01:2

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 68c444efb21ba63948785baf54baaf6aca3d63d8
address
tb1qdrzyfmajrwnrjjrctwh4fw40dt9r6c7ch4vufr
transaction
1bb80c104d720dd19ca553bee163fa7c7c12a68ea61cfc5695a88ffe0026cd01
confirmations
51895
spent
true